// Fixture for the Queuewright autoscaler integration tests.
// Simulates a backlog ramp from 0 to 12,000 messages over 90s,
// then a sudden drain, to verify scale-up latency and the
// cooldown guard against flapping. Thresholds here mirror
// production defaults in scaler-config.yaml; if you change one,
// change both, or the assertions on replica counts will drift.
// The fake metrics endpoint authenticates requests, so the
// harness must present the bearer token below when polling.

bearer token for tawig-bahif: eyJhbGciOiJIUzI1NiIsInR5cCI6IkpXVCJ9.eyJzdWIiOiIo-yiO33jvEIn0.T9qLInSAqhTN

Subject: Key rotation — Placefinder widget

Team,

We rotated the internal credential for the Placefinder address autocomplete widget this morning. Old key dies Friday. If a customer reports empty suggestions, confirm their install pulled the update before escalating. Support tooling that queries the Placefinder backend directly must switch now. The new internal key is below.

app token of bawep-hafog = kto7_vwrmnlx

## Deployment

The Fernlock template renderer is CPU-bound; scale horizontally, never vertically. Warm the template cache after each deploy by hitting the priming endpoint, or first-request latency will spike. Render times above 200ms page on-call. Rollbacks are safe; compiled templates are versioned per release. The renderer reads its tuning values at startup, listed below.

deployment values, yahag-tawef:
ZORWYN_HOST=zorwyn.tolvaqlabs.internal
ZORWYN_PORT=9300

## Artifact signing — SquatterScan

Hey on-call: SquatterScan (our typo-squatting package scanner) ships signed artifacts so the mirror nodes refuse anything unsigned. If the scanner suddenly stops pulling rule updates, nine times out of ten it's a signature verification failure, not a network thing. Check the verifier logs first, then confirm the artifact was signed with the current generation key — we rotated last quarter and a few old docs still reference the dead one. The current signing key you should verify against is below.

signing key of bagap-yawep = bky13_TbfT6ZMUoGJo2